Tennessee AD John Currie announces plans to complete $450M renovation of Neyland Stadium
Posted on 6/16/17 at 3:44 pm
Posted on 6/16/17 at 3:44 pm
The first $106M phase was announced in October. Currie said today that the following two phases are on track to be completed in time for Neyland Stadium's 100th season in 2021. The last renovation of the stadium was completed in 2010.
Phase I ($106M; will be completed between 18 and 19 seasons)
Concourse Renovations
West Side Chairback Seating and Field Club Additions
South Field Membership Club Addition
Phase II (Estimated $150M; hopes to be completed between 19 and 20 seasons)
Additional Concourse Renovations
Addition of Suites in Southwest Corner
Addition of New Recruiting Room, Halftime Meeting Room and New Letter Winners' Lounge
Phase III (Estimated $190M; hopes to be completed between 20 and 21 seasons)
Two New 123 x 32 Videoboards
Completion of Exterior Brick Facade around entire Stadium and New Plazas in Southwest and Southeast Corners of Stadium
